Local film barred for 'undermining national security'

On the Media Development Authority's decision to bar local director Tan Pin Pin's documentary film, “To Singapore, With Love”, for undermining national security, SMU Associate Professor of Law Eugene Tan said that if the views of these political exiles were to be easily and widely available, it could deal a “severe injustice” to those who suffered during the violent confrontation. The film is about self-professed exiles – including members or supporters of the now-defunct Communist Party of Malaya (CPM) – who are living overseas.
